Case Study : ACE Inhibitor Overdose
History:A 33-year-old woman arrives at the emergency department, visibly distressed, with complaints of fever and diarrhea. She tearfully admits to ingesting 20 enalapril tablets approximately 30 minutes before arrival. She insists she is not currently suicidal and has taken no other medications. The pills belonged to her father.
Past Medical History (PMH): None.
Physical Examination:
Temperature: 100.8°F
Heart Rate: 100 bpm
Respiratory Rate: 18 breaths per minute
Blood Pressure: 80/40 mm Hg
General: Awake and alert, but visibly upset.
HEENT: No abnormalities noted.
Pulmonary: Clear breath sounds, no respiratory distress.
Cardiovascular: Regular heart rate and rhythm, no murmurs.
Abdomen: Soft, non-tender.
Neurologic: Cranial nerves II-XII intact, normal muscle strength.
1. What Are the Signs and Symptoms of an ACE Inhibitor Overdose?
Overdosing on ACE inhibitors like enalapril is typically not life-threatening but can lead to several notable symptoms, primarily related to blood pressure regulation and kidney function. The most common symptoms include:
Hypotension (low blood pressure): Can lead to dizziness, fainting, or even shock in severe cases.
Diarrhea and nausea: Gastrointestinal distress is common in overdose scenarios.
Angioedema: Although rare, swelling of the lips, tongue, or throat can occur, leading to potential airway obstruction.
Hyperkalemia (elevated potassium levels): Can cause muscle weakness, irregular heart rhythms, and, in extreme cases, cardiac arrest.
Drug fever and rash: Some patients may experience fever and skin irritation as a reaction to the overdose.
2. How Should the Hypotension Be Managed?
The primary concern in this patient is her low blood pressure (80/40 mm Hg). Management should be tailored to improving circulation and preventing organ damage. The key interventions include:
Positioning: Laying the patient supine with legs elevated to promote blood flow to vital organs.
Intravenous (IV) Fluids: Rapid administration of isotonic saline or lactated Ringer’s solution to restore intravascular volume.
Vasopressors: If fluid resuscitation is insufficient, medications such as norepinephrine or dopamine may be used to maintain blood pressure.
Monitoring: Continuous assessment of blood pressure, heart rate, kidney function, and electrolytes, especially potassium levels.
3. How Do Angiotensin-Converting Enzyme (ACE) Inhibitors Work?
ACE inhibitors function by blocking the conversion of angiotensin I to angiotensin II, a powerful vasoconstrictor responsible for raising blood pressure. By inhibiting this process, ACE inhibitors:
Reduce blood vessel constriction, leading to lower blood pressure.
Decrease sodium and water retention, which helps manage hypertension and heart failure.
Increase bradykinin levels, which can lead to vasodilation but also contribute to side effects such as coughing and angioedema.
Conclusion
This patient’s enalapril overdose has resulted in symptomatic hypotension, requiring immediate fluid resuscitation and careful monitoring. While ACE inhibitor overdoses are usually not fatal, complications like severe hypotension, hyperkalemia, and angioedema must be anticipated and managed accordingly. Given her emotional distress, a psychiatric evaluation should also be considered to ensure her overall well-being.
